Output 3e71f856c0f7474c1d9540546158373dec5edd8111668199484336a51af36843:1

value
1800068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c4fc1b8bbda5974b82b684699e9ec074a0aad1 OP_EQUAL
address
3DLbiedyp2QGJBjU5hVrbcwzA9GUTX2pjR
transaction
3e71f856c0f7474c1d9540546158373dec5edd8111668199484336a51af36843
confirmations
362741
spent
true